Specifications

The Nalge Nunc Laboratory Bottles, Teflon PFA, Narrow Mouth, NALGENE DS1630-0001, Case of 8 are characterized by several key specifications:

  • Capacity: 30 mL (1 oz). This compact size is perfect for carrying small, essential quantities of liquids.
  • Cap Size: 20-415. The standardized thread size ensures a secure and leak-proof seal.
  • Material: Teflon PFA (Perfluoroalkoxy). PFA offers exceptional chemical resistance and temperature stability.
  • Temperature Range: -270°C to 250°C (-454°F to 482°F). This extreme temperature range allows for use in a wide variety of environments and applications.
  • Closure: Linerless, leakproof Teflon PFA. The linerless design eliminates the risk of contamination from liner materials.
  • Autoclavable: Yes. Autoclavability ensures sterilization for critical applications.
  • Quantity: Case of 8. Provides a sufficient number of bottles for various tasks.

These specifications are crucial because they directly impact the performance and reliability of the bottles. The Teflon PFA construction ensures that the bottles are chemically inert, preventing contamination of the contents. The wide temperature range allows for use in extreme environments, making the Nalge Nunc bottles suitable for fieldwork in any climate. The leakproof closure guarantees that the contents remain safely contained, preventing spills and accidents.

Accessories and Customization Options

The Nalge Nunc Laboratory Bottles come standard with a leakproof Teflon PFA closure. Due to their intended use, customization options are limited. However, the bottles can be labeled with chemical-resistant markers to identify the contents.

The 20-415 thread size is a common standard. This could allow for adaptation with some specialized caps or dispensing closures from other brands, though this may compromise the bottle’s original certified leakproof status.
